Browns v. San Francisco 49ers

Sunday, 1 p.m., in Huntington Bank Field

Record: 8-4.

Last game: Defeated Carolina Panthers, 20-9, November 24, in Santa Clara, CA.

Coach: Kyle Shanahan, 86-70, ninth year.

Series record: Browns lead, 13-8.

Last meeting: Browns won, 19-17, October 15, 2023, in Cleveland.

League rankings: Offense is 10th overall (26th rushing, third passing), defense is 22nd overall (10th rushing, 26th passing), and turnover differential is minus-6.

Things to watch

1. The year started out great for quarterback Brock Purdy, who was given a $265 million, five-year contract in May with $181 million in guarantees. Almost on cue, Purdy’s football season has gone downhill ever since. A turf toe injury caused him to miss eight games, during which QB2 Mac Jones went 5-3 with a passer rating of 97.4. In his second game back on Monday night, Purdy was intercepted three times in the first half against the Panthers and then limited himself to checkdowns in the second half. Purdy’s 5.3 interception rate is third-worst in the NFL and more than twice as bad as his previous high and his 88.6 passer rating is 14.5 points lower than his career average.

2. Amid problems at receiver and, most recently, quarterback, the 49ers’ offense has focused on running back Christian McCaffrey throughout the season. McCaffrey leads the NFL with 1,581 yards from scrimmage (796 rushing, 785 receiving) and has 12 total touchdowns.

3. With edge rusher Nick Bosa out since September with a torn ACL, creating pass pressure has been a problem for the defense. The 49ers are last in the NFL with 13 sacks. (For comparison, Myles Garrett has 18 by himself!) and last with 57 quarterback pressures (hurries + knockdowns + sacks). In June, the 49ers traded with the Eagles for edge rusher Bryce Huff, and he has beend the lone threat on their defensive front with four sacks, six tackles for loss, and 13 quarterback hits. The 49ers also have been without star linebacker Fred Warner (dislocated and fractured ankle) since Week 6.

4. Matt Gay is the 49ers’ third kicker this season. Jake Moody was replaced by Eddy Pineiro after the first game. Pineiro was 22 of 22 on field goals in 10 games, but missed the Carolina game with a hamstring injury. Gay was 2 for 2 on field goals and 2 for 2 on PATs v. the Panthers.

Did you know … ?

1. Since 2008, Jim Schwartz has a personal record of 8-1 against Kyle Shanahan in games in which they faced each other as head coaches or coordinators. This record does not include one meeting when Schwartz was a defensive consultant with the Tennessee Titans.

2. Receiver Jauan Jennings was not suspended for slapping Carolina safety Tre’von Moehrig in the face mask after the game on Monday night. Instead, Moehrig received a one-game suspension by the NFL for punching Jennings in the groin area late in the game. Jennings did not retaliate during the game, but made his feelings known with his open-handed right cross to Moehrig’s face mask.

3. Receiver Brandon Aiyuk has yet to play this season after having surgery last October to repair an ACL and MCL in his right knee. He and the team are squabbling about a $26 million guarantee contained in his $120 million contract extension receintly voided by the club. The 49ers reportedly accepted a trade offer from the Browns for Aiyuk last summer before the contract extension was worked out. If the 49ers try to trade Aiyuk again, the Browns are considered a potential interested team.

4. The 49ers have won the turnover battle in only two games. They have it six times but managed to go 3-3 in those games.

Small world: Kyle Shanahan was Browns offensive coordinator in 2014 … special teams coordinator Brant Boyer was a linebacker for the Browns in 2001-04 and was a coaching intern in 2009 … run game coordinator/tight ends coach Brian Fleury coached Browns linebackers in 2014-15 … linebackers coach Johnny Holland was Browns inside linebackers coach in 2016 … defensive tackle Jordan Elliott was a Browns’ third-round draft pick in 2020 and played with them through 2023 … fullback Kyle Juszczyk was born in Median and attended Cloverleaf HS in Lodi .. offensive quality control coach Deuce Schwartz was a Browns defensive quality control coach in 2019.
